Minnetonka One-Act Play Heads to State Tourney Stage

The cast of Minnetonka High School's one-act play is headed to the state tournament. 

MHS won the Minnesota State High School League 6AA One Act Play Sections with a cut of Wit by Margaret Edson. The cast competes Thursday, Feb. 7 at 11:45 a.m. at O'Shaughnessy Auditorium on the St. Catherine University campus (Directions). The price is $10 for a single session or $15 for a daily pass.

Thursday, February 7
9:15am - Section 1AA
10:00am - Section 8AA
11:00 am - Section 3AA
*11:45am - Section 6AA - MHS*
1:30pm - Section 7AA
2:15pm - Section 5AA
3:15pm - Section 4AA
4:00pm - Section 2AA
